On increasing temperature at constant pressure, the amount of gas adsorbed at the surface per unit mass of adsorbent

Answer: A,C
π‘ Solution & Explanation
Physisorption decreases continuously with temperature (a). Chemisorption initially increases because of the activation energy requirement (c).
